## Data stores — Quillmark invoice renderer

The renderer uses two stores: a blob bucket for finished PDFs and a relational DB for invoice metadata, template versions, and render job status. Retention on rendered PDFs is two years. The metadata database is reached via the connection string below.

replica DSN, kajep-yahag: mssql://praok_svc:iF@db-8d68.plorvaio.local:5432/eliion

/*
 * RestockPilot client setup — for external plugin authors.
 * This client talks to the Corridor restock-planning API: it pulls
 * machine inventory snapshots, predicts sell-through, and returns a
 * suggested restock route. Plugins must call init() before any
 * planner methods. Rate limit: 60 req/min per plugin. Sandbox data
 * only; production machines are off-limits. Initialize the client
 * with the key below.
 */

API key for bahop-yajog: qvz3-mhf

# Bramblehold Wiki — Environments

Bramblehold runs three environments: dev, staging, and prod. Access is role-based: Readers can view all spaces, Editors can modify dev and staging pages, and Stewards alone may edit prod-facing documentation. New team members start as Readers and request upgrades from their team Steward. Each environment loads the following configuration.

service settings:
WENATH_PIN=5007
WENATH_METRICS_HOST=metrics.wenath.tolvaqlabs.corp
WENATH_LOG_LEVEL=debug
WENATH_TENANT=rusox

Checklist item 3 — Off-site run: calibration weights

Hi — quick one for the Thornbury office. The batch of calibration weights from Quentall Metrology is going out on tomorrow's run to the Ashfold lab. Make sure each weight stays in its foam case (they're fussy about fingerprints and knocks), count all twelve against the slip, and sign the custody log before the driver leaves. If anything's missing, ring the lab first, not the courier. The driver should then follow the confidential hand-over step set out just below.

dispatch memo: the eliath belael courier leaves the praox ledger at gate 8841 under passcode 017589